What happens on a psychological level when an empath finally decides to prioritize their own well-being? This isn't a turn toward selfishness, but a profound transformation toward wholeness, as explored by Carl Jung's work on individuation. We delve into the concept of the "shadow" and how integrating the capacity for self-preservation doesn't diminish empathy—it refines it into discernment. Discover the stages of this quiet revolution: from the necessary "dark night of the soul" realization, through the reclamation of personal energy, to the ultimate state of being psychologically sovereign. Learn how this shift alters every relationship dynamic and leads to what Jung termed the "transcendent function"—the ability to hold both compassion and unwavering boundaries.
